USB-6008 compatibility

I am looking to replace my DAQPad-6020E (777474-01) in an overdesigned system with a low-cost DAQ, preferably with the USB-6008 or 6009 (size is an issue). The 6020E uses Traditional NI-DAQ(v7.4.1) support, where the USB-6008/9 is listed as using the NI-DAQmx(v8.1). The application I believe was written in VC++ .NET and GUI developed with LabView(v7). Is there any possibility that I can get away with only having the DLL rewritten?

Hi,

It really depends on how your code was written. There is quite a big difference in programming between NI-DAQ and NI DAQmx but if all the acquisition is handled in the C++ dll, you could just have that rewritten, it isn't just a matter of replacing the functions though.

Just a caution regarding 600x hardware. I advise that you carefully review the specifications and limitations of the devices to be sure that they are suitable for your application. Some recurring issues that people who do not look at the specs and then find out later that they are not suitable for their applications are:

Limited AO SW timed update rate of 150Hz max and just 0-5V output range, low AI input impedance of only 144Kohm which can load down your signals and cause errors in measurements, and AI input for single ended configuration only has +/-10V range.

AnalogKid, I did check the specs carefully several times since I'm new to this, but thank you for pointing it out. My req's are 4 DIFF analog in (0-5V range from sources), and a sample rate min of 2 samples/sec/channel. I'm still trying to figure out why the original drawing utilized a DAQPad-6020E, and a DAQPad-1200 before that.
